Which of the following is a control tactic commonly used in labor trafficking?

Explanation:
Withholding pay and document confiscation is a prevalent control tactic used in labor trafficking, as it serves to increase dependency and limit the ability of victims to escape. By withholding pay, traffickers ensure that victims do not have the financial means to leave their situation, thereby reinforcing control over them. Furthermore, confiscating important documents, such as identification and work permits, prevents victims from accessing legal protections and seeking help, effectively trapping them in exploitative working conditions.
